About the Role

Ethos is seeking a highly motivated Staff Accountant with CPA firm experience, public company, or start-up experience. The successful candidate will be responsible for working with cross functional teams to fully understand Ethos’ business, supporting month end financial close, and helping implement changes to our systems, processes, and controls.

Duties and Responsibilities:

  • Prepare journal entries, reconciliations, and analyses in accordance with U.S. GAAP and internal company policies
  • Consistently meet month-end close deadlines for assigned tasks
  • Support month end/ quarterly / year end operations, AP, cash, credit card management, and support ad hoc projects as needed
  • Perform operational accounting tasks to support overall business including: coding invoices, reconciling vendor accounts, bank accounts and monitoring corporate credit card transactions
  • Develop and maintain documentation of current accounting policies
  • Support other accounting team members by researching accounting issues
  • Participate in special projects to review and improve control environment and drive efficiencies
  • Partner with the Finance team to analyze historical results and improve information quality

Qualifications and Skills:

  • 2 – 4 years of relevant transactional accounting, industry experience, or audit experience
  • Understanding of U.S. GAAP
  • Self-starter and self-motivated to work independently in a fast-paced environment
  • Organized, detail-oriented and deadline-driven
  • Excellent communication skills (written and verbal) and experience in working with stakeholders across all levels within cross-functional teams
  • Strong Excel skills (V look ups, Pivot Tables) and ability to work with large data sets
  • Education: B.A./B.S. in Accounting or Finance from an accredited college or university
  • CPA or CPA candidate considered a plus
